Wolves At The Gate have something here, id like to see them expand their talent, but this EP is pretty good. It is well produced and the lyrics are not cheesy. The music over all is nothing new to this genre, but it does get my head moving.
If you take away the cheesy intro this EP is great. The cleans are one of the best parts of the record and really shine through at times. Lyrically, it's pretty good and they don't shove the christian stuff straight in your face which is a misake some religious bands do. Overall it's a well-produced enjoyable listen that shows this group can possibly make some noise in the future.
